Transaction 5d994860726e50bd31dc65fcdcb09000deeca08fd025d7797f27855008e1ae1b
2 Input
2 Outputs
- 5d994860726e50bd31dc65fcdcb09000deeca08fd025d7797f27855008e1ae1b:0
- 5d994860726e50bd31dc65fcdcb09000deeca08fd025d7797f27855008e1ae1b:1
value 31347000
address 1Q28EZMFyE5YSo3EDFwyJDQgELA4pJkRKj
value 74575000
address 17wLV1vwUFmFM41yMeWGN19eyx66bXeYrc